Title :
From Internet of Things to the Virtual Continuum: An architectural view

Abstract :
This paper aims at introducing a set of requirements for large Internet of Things platforms. These platforms should enable the programming of many services comprising functions provided by a large number of sensors and intelligent resources. The paper aims at showing how virtualization and cognitive capabilities will play a fundamental role in order to enable the concept of the Virtual Continuum, i.e., the functional augmentation and entanglement of physical objects and virtualized ones. The Virtual Continuum makes possible the exploitation of new business models like servitization.
